well you can try the various pandora/MMS tutorials available but i'm sorry to say you are most likely up the creek at the moment.

a PSP coming with OFW 4.05 is more than likely a TA-088 v3 motherboard which is currently unhackable ... Dark Alex will have to figure out a way to pull it off before you can install CFW.

if you purchase a pandora battery or a service mode tool there is no risk in trying it ... when you put the pandora battery/MMS in it simply won't work ... it won't actually do anything cause the new CPU won't let the hacked firmware load off the stick.

no. the point of which batteryes is to bring the psp into service mode.. and when service mode inabled with the program on the memmory stick, inseted in the psp. that will run the program auto.

thats how the firmware is installed.

inshort there the same thing..but if you pandora your battery and then restore it..try not to pandora it again, as doing so too many times could fry the battery.
